Output af96892e26667b57dbcf7406b38d8f5fcaca2efce0360765a69ff737ffc8a1d7:0

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 623eb3bfc7db29cb76dd01beeea2bc7b58a1ec0f OP_EQUAL
address
3AeVFxu1SLMEJPuZtAFjzJLDw3KT4DjHB8
transaction
af96892e26667b57dbcf7406b38d8f5fcaca2efce0360765a69ff737ffc8a1d7